🇳🇴 Norway Promoted To World Junior Top Division In 2024


For the first time since 2014, Norway will be returning to the World Junior Championship Top Division, after defeating Kazakhstan today 5-3 on home ice in Asker, capturing the Division IA title and booking a trip to next year’s tournament in Gothenburg, Sweden.

🇨🇦 IIHF Names Brampton As 2023 Women’s World Championship Host


Today the International Ice Hockey Federation confirmed that the Canadian city to host the 2023 Women’s World Championships would be the Toronto-area suburb of Brampton, Ontario, running from 05-16 April 2023.

IIHF Hall Of Fame Announces 2023 Inductees


The IIHF has announced the Hall Of Fame Class of 2023, to be inducted at May’s World Championships in Tampere, Finland, with five different nationalities highlighting the class, as the IIHF will induct Henrik Zetterberg, Brian Leetch, Caroline Ouellette, Cristobal Huet and Jimmy Foster to the Hall.

🇸🇪 Börje Salming: 1951-2022


Less than two weeks after being honoured in front of his adopted hometown of Toronto, Börje Salming, the legendary Swedish defenceman who helped clear the path for European-trained players to star as professionals in the National Hockey League, today succumbed to ALS at the age of 71 in his native Sweden.

🇫🇮 Noora Räty Announces Retirement From Finnish National Team


Finnish goaltender Noora Räty, arguably the greatest goaltender in women’s hockey history, and a multiple World Championship and Olympic medallist, today announced in a shocking social media post that, at only age 33, she would no longer play for the Naisleijonat.

🇸🇰 Zdeno Chára Announces Retirement Following Illustrious 25 Year Career


Slovakian defenceman Zdeno Chára, whose towering presence (the tallest player in NHL history at 6’9) and dominating play terrorized NHL offences for a quarter century, today announced his retirement from hockey at the age of 45, following 25 pro seasons with Ottawa, Boston, Washington and the New York Islanders, ending his career signing a one-day contract with the Boston Bruins.

🇫🇮 🇱🇻 2023 World Championship Schedule Released


The schedule for the 2023 IIHF World Championship was today announced for the tournament taking place in Tampere, Finland and Rīga, Latvia, with the two previous Worlds hosts stepping in to replace Saint Petersburg, Russia as the hosts, who were stripped as hosts after Russia was banned from IIHF competition for their continued invasion of Ukraine.
